"La Llorona" is a song from Disney and Pixar's 2017 animated film Coco. It is a duet between the heroic Imelda and the wicked Ernesto de la Cruz.
The song was performed by Imelda and de Cruz's voice actors, Alanna Ubach and Antonio Sol, respectively.

Trivia
- The song itself is a traditional Mexican folk song about a ghostly spirit of the same name from Latin American folklore who weeps over the loss of her children.
